Least-Square Fitting Analysis using Henderson-Hasselbalch equation for amphoteric compound was insufficient to describe ofloxacin solubility process in a series of pH.ġ. This mean that there was a salting in phenomena. Ofloxacin solubility in various ionic strengths showed that stronger ionic strength solution caused an increase in ofloxacin solubility. Changing the solution pH from 6.2 to 1.5 or to 12.5 affected the solubility of ofloxacin increased about 9.96 and 8.64 times higher, respectively. However, the solubility decreased at pH’s between pKa1 and pKa2. ![]() Results showed that ofloxacin solubility increased at pH’s below the pKa1 value (6.08) and above the pKa2 value (8.25). Solubility experiments were carried out using shaking thermostatic-waterbath for 3 hours at a temperature of 37☌ ± 1☌. Ofloxacin solubilities were measured at various pH ranged from 1.5 to 12.5 and ionic strengths from 0.01 to 0.20 respectively. The objectives of this research was to investigate the effects of pH and ionic strength on solubility profile of ofloxacin. ![]() Ofloxacin solubility is dependent on pH of the solvent due to its amphoteric properties. Ofloxacin is an antibiotic and categorized as class 2 in Biopharmaceutics Classification System (BCS).
